Responsibilities
- As The Support Coordinator, Your Role Specifically Will Explore mainstream, community, advocate, informal and NDIS provider options with participants so they are engaged in the decision making of choices and options available.
- Support participants to establish their MyID account, navigate the NDIS Portal, negotiate services to be provided and support participants to establish service agreements with providers of their choice.
- Negotiate services and prices as part of any quotable supports as decided by the participant.
- Arrange any relevant assessments to determine the nature and type of funding required (e.g. complex home modifications).
- Liaise with Plan Managers on funding, support types, payments etc. where relevant.
- Link participants to mainstream and/or community services (e.g. housing, education, transport, health) as required.
- Sustain and enhance participants\' capacity to coordinate supports, self-direct and manage supports and participate in the community, including providing assistance to resolve problems, understand responsibilities under service agreements, and change or end a service agreement.
